When you choose to pursue your studies at the University of Alberta, you will become part of a dynamic environment that encourages you to learn new things, develop new skills, and prepare for life's challenges. You will enjoy an exceptional quality of life and education on a friendly campus that welcomes students with different backgrounds and unique experiences.
Founded a century ago, the University of Alberta is one of the top 100 teaching and research universities in the world serving more than 36,000 students with 11,000 faculty and staff.
It offers close to 400 undergraduate, graduate and professional programs in 18 faculties.

Scholarship Description
Qualification Criteria
The Scholarship is awarded based on the following:
Academic Level/Class: Graduate / Doctoral
Graduate / Masters
Major in Department: Food Science & Human Nutrition
Renewable: This Scholarship is Renewable
Must be enrolled as a Food Science Mater's of Doctoral degree program candidate in the Department of Food Science and Human Nutrition.
Preference will be given to a student who has a financial need for such an assistantship.
The recipient(s) shall be selected according to the Department of Food Science and Human Nutrition's procedures for selecting assistantship recipients
